About the team:
Core Technology (CT) is a distributed team responsible for the end-to-end eBay technology platform. This platform runs our entire infrastructure and all the services that come together to form ebay.com. We are a world leader in mobile commerce and directly impact the lives of a global population. Our iOS apps, with millions of daily active users, facilitate billions in commerce transactions and are the entry point for a growing number of new customers.
Our tightly knit team enjoys working on large-scale ambitious and interesting problems. We work in small focused, collaborative project teams following an agile methodology. Multi-functional teams including product management, product development, and User Experience Design (UXD) work daily to create a successful product that delights our customers. You will feel like you're working in a start-up, whilst at the same time having the resources of a large company.
About the Role:
eBay's is looking for an iOS Engineer who is passionate about crafting apps consumers love. This is an outstanding opportunity to join a world leader in mobile commerce and directly impact the lives of a global population while growing the revenue of eBay exponentially. The iOS product development team is responsible for developing and deploying the eBay iOS apps (iPhone, iPad): ;br>
What you will accomplish:
- Crafting/giving functional and technical direction to a solution
- Test-driven development (TDD)/Behavior Driven Development (BDD), clean code, software craftsmanship
- Testing at all levels (unit, integration, UI and acceptance)
- Refactoring to enhance testability and re-usability
- Continuous delivery and integration
- Identify project risks, quantify risk/benefit relationships
What you will bring:
- Bachelor's degree from an accredited College or University in Computer Science or related major and 5+ years of mobile development experience
- Experience in iOS, Swift, Objective-C, and XCode as well as familiarity with the integration of network services
- Knowledge of GraphQL, REST is helpful
- Knows about Async/Await, concurrency, combine, UIkit, SwiftUI and various iOS development frameworks essential for Mobile Application development
- Full stack development experience is a bonus
